Classis Multi Bag Filter Housing is designed for optimum filtration performance. Its range provides filtration solutions for a broad variety of fluid applications in the process industry. They are particularly useful for filtering large volumes of high viscosity liquids. Bag filter is constructed of the filter housing, filter bags, internal cage to support bags, positive sealing arrangement, & choice of end connections. The internal support ensures bags will not burst as high differential pressures build up during operation. Unfiltered fluid enters the housing and is distributed evenly around the filter bags. Filtration takes place from inside to outside. Solids are collected on the inside of the filter bag for easy removal. The filtered fluid then exits through the outlet pipe.
